What are Weekend Mainframe jobs?

Weekend Mainframe jobs involve managing, monitoring, and maintaining mainframe computer systems during weekend shifts. These roles ensure that large-scale computer operations, such as data processing, batch jobs, and system backups, run smoothly when regular staff may be off-duty. Employees in these positions typically troubleshoot issues, perform routine maintenance, and respond to system alerts to minimize downtime. Weekend Mainframe professionals are essential for organizations that require 24/7 uptime and reliability for their critical IT infrastructure.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Weekend Mainframe Operator,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Weekend Mainframe Operator, you need a solid understanding of mainframe systems, batch processing, and job scheduling, typically supported by experience with z/OS or similar platforms. Familiarity with tools like IBM JCL, TSO/ISPF, monitoring software, and sometimes certifications like IBM Certified System Programmer are commonly required. Strong probl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and effective communication help operators respond quickly to system alerts and coordinate with technical teams. These skills ensure reliable system uptime and efficient issue resolution during critical off-peak hours.

What are some unique challenges of working as a Weekend Mainframe Operator?

As a Weekend Mainframe Operator, you'll often work independently or with a smaller team compared to weekday shifts, which can mean taking on greater responsibility for monitoring and troubleshooting systems. Weekend shifts may require handling scheduled maintenance or updates and responding promptly to incidents, sometimes with limited immediate support from other departments. Strong problem-solving skills and the ability to follow detailed procedures are essential, as issues can arise outside of standard business hours. This role offers a valuable opportunity to develop autonomy and expertise in mainframe operations, which can lead to advancement into senior or weekday positions.

Job description

Mainframe Admin
Downey, CA
12 months
Responsibilities:
Provide network architecture guidance and improvements for the design of the new z/OS 2.4 zEnterprise Communications Server infrastructure.
Design, implement and support the Communications Systems Services (CSSMTP) customization for mainframe files attachment.
Design, implement, and support communications access to the Client's cloud tertiary data site.
Enhance Williams Data Systems (WDS) enterprise monitoring/alerts.
Participate in Business Continuity exercises including testing, documentation and configuration of the z/Enterprise Communications Server environment at the Local Recovery Center.
Attend Problem and Change meetings in order to support Network Systems activities in these areas as well as resolve open Cherwell help desk incidents assigned to the IBM OS/COM Section.
Provide on-call technical support as required during outages including weekends and off hours.
Plan and schedule network software changes as required to be implemented according to Client's change policies and available maintenance windows.
Provide for knowledge transfer throughout the contract period to permanent IBM OS/COM staff.
Attend related project and design meetings and discussions directed by management; and perform special projects and initiatives as assigned.
Required Skills:
1. Five (5) years of experience within the last seven (7) years with IBM zEnterprise mainframe implementing MultiPath Channel (MPC) alternate routing links in a systems programming troubleshooting support role.
2. Five (5) years of experience within the last seven (7) years with IBM zEnterprise mainframe hardware maintenance console interface in a systems programming troubleshooting support role.
3. Five (5) years of experience within the last seven (7) years customizing the IBM zEnterprise mainframe Communications Systems Services (CSSMTP) for mainframe file attachment.
4. Three (3) years of experience within the last five (5) years installing, maintaining and upgrading the zEnterprise Communications Server mainframe TLS/SSL security, policy-based network and Digital Certificate Implementation and support.
5. Three (3) years of experience within the last five (5) years supporting IBM zEnterprise mainframe Communications Systems and Virtual Tape System storage disaster vaulting communication links.
